As natural pizzas gain space in the supermarket freezer, busy foodies can now enjoy a fast, healthful slice a casa. We tried 18 pies (all without artificial flavors or preservatives) to find the tastiest cheese, veggie, and mediterranean pizzas on ice. these three made the upper crust.
Best Cheese: Frontera Four Cheese ($6) This flavorful, all-natural pie shines with a hint of cilantro and a spicy chili kick courtesy of chef Rick Bayless, the guru of Mexican cuisine. Its crisp crust holds its own against the mix of four cheeses and a roasted tomato garnish.
Best Veggie: Whole Kitchen Organic Vegetable ($4.70) With a thick wheat-flour crust, oregano-specked tomato sauce, and big chunks of zucchini, eggplant, peppers, and broccoli in every bite, Whole Food's pizza will have even nonvegetarians raving -- and asking for more.
Best Mediterranean: American Flatbread Ionian Awakening ($6) In what amounts to a tableside Greek vacation, a hefty serving of halved Kalamata olives and onions sits atop a blend of feta, mozzarella, and Parmesan cheeses. This organic pizza pie from the growing Vermont-based bakery is worth staying home for.
